Detailed Solution

(a) The function of three segment of a transistor are:
1. Emitter
2. Base
3. Collector
Emitter: It is a heavily doped and of moderate size. it supplies the large number of majority charge carries for the flow of current through the transistor.
Base: It is the central region. It is very thin and lightly doped. It controls the movement of charge carries coming from emitter region.
Collector: It is moderately doped ad large sized as compared to emitter. It collects a major portion of the majority carries supplied by the emitter.
